“It makes me want to cry,” claims Andy Ruiz Jr (35-2, 22 KOs), recalling the poor preparation, or rather the lack thereof, for the rematch with Anthony Joshua (26-3, 22 KOs) in 2019. ...

Today, Destroyer would like to complete the trilogy with Joshua, although he also aims to Alexandra Usika (21-0, 14 KOs) and Tyson Fury (33-0-1, 24 KOs).

“I would like to fight Usyk, Fury or Joshua. With the latter it would have been a trilogy. I did everything wrong before the rematch. I just didn't prepare for the second fight. Then he should have knocked me out, to be honest, I don’t know how I survived those twelve rounds. But I’ve learned my lesson and if I get my world title back, I’ll do everything right and I’ll be champion for a lot longer,” Ruiz Jr. said.
